Why Are You Seeing This Error?
Photo saved as PNG from editing app (Canva, Photoshop, GIMP)
Screenshot taken and used as passport photo (screenshots are PNG by default)
iPhone in HEIC mode — converted to PNG not JPEG on share
WhatsApp or Google Photos export saved as PNG
Image downloaded from the internet in PNG or WebP format

Government exam portals use strict file type validation to enforce size limits (PNG is lossless and larger than JPEG). JPEG allows controlled compression to 10KB, 20KB, etc., which is why portals mandate it. PNG files at the same visual quality would be 5–10× larger.
